From 4c042ee9ee6e588a0d08f6fd315df05837345702 Mon Sep 17 00:00:00 2001 From: Michael Gangolf Date: Sun, 25 Sep 2022 19:17:34 +0200 Subject: [PATCH] feat(android): ignoreLog config (#13560) --- android/cli/hooks/run.js |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/android/cli/hooks/run.js b/android/cli/hooks/run.js index 8a19acb9ca2..0d5d1081d8b 100644 --- a/android/cli/hooks/run.js +++ b/android/cli/hooks/run.js @@ -18,6 +18,7 @@ exports.cliVersion = '>=3.2'; exports.init = function (logger, config, cli) { let deviceInfo = []; + const ignoreLog = config.cli.ignoreLog || []; cli.on('build.pre.compile', { priority: 8000, @@ -266,6 +267,13 @@ exports.init = function (logger, config, cli) { return; } + // ignore some Android logs in info log level + for (let i = 0, len = ignoreLog.length; i < len; ++i) { + if (line.includes(ignoreLog[i])) { + return; + } + } + switch (logLevel) { case 'v': logger.trace(line);